SHASA chasing your vote to secure Sunsuper grant funding for solar on social housing in Moruya


Sunsuper's Dreams for a Better World Eurobodalla's Southcoast Health and Sustainability Alliance (SHASA) is one of six organisations that have been short listed for the chance to share in $150,000 in grants from Sunsuper’s Dreams for a Better World. SHASA want to install solar on social housing in Moruya and are calling on the Eurobodalla community to vote for its project to secure much needed funding. SHASA's dream is to end energy poverty with free power from the sun. SHASA wants to install 40kw of solar on social housing in Moruya. This will generate $18,688 in annual savings on electricity bills for very low income households in Moruya. It will enable these households to redirect scarce funds to other living costs and to improve their comfort levels as the climate becomes more hostile.
